The Ritchie Family had released 4 albums over the span of just 2 years, but in early 1978 Cassandra, Cheryl & Gwendolyn started to voice their discontent that they had no creative input in the group's artistic direction. They were, however, shocked to receive a letter from Can't Stop Productions, announcing their contract had ended with immediate effect, with no further explanation given. Instead three new girls had been signed up to become the new Ritchie Family. Also their lyricist and vocal co-producer Phil Hurtt knew nothing about it. “I didn’t know what had happened,” he later recalled. “When I went to the studio for the sessions that followed that, there were three new girls in front of me. Where’d they come from?” Gwendolyn was pregnant by now and retired from show business, but Cassandra & Cheryl teamed up with Michelle Simpson for the trio CasMiJac and sang backing vocals for John Lennon & Yoko Ono on their Double Fantasy album 1980. The shock of John Lennon's murder shortly after made Cassandra & Cheryl give up on showbiz altogether. Cassandra became a mother in 1981 and worked as an admin on a hospital. Cheryl remarried in 1983 and became Cheryl Mason Dorman and worked in the educational system, becoming a Doctor in 2013.The second line-up of The Ritchie Family disbanded quietly in 1984, having released a further five albums. "The Best Disco In Town" was remixed in 1987 to little success, and Jacques Morali passed away in 1991 from AIDS, but with the revival of disco in the 90s, the interest in The Ritchie Family was renewed and would see the second line-up perform occasionally, also performing the signature tune of the first line-up in their set. It was Hans de Vries who tracked down the original line-up in 2010 and started creating a tribute page on Facebook, much to Cassandra, Cheryl & Gwendolyn's delight as they thought they had been all forgotten since 1978. While Gwendolyn had no desire to tour again, Cheryl & Cassandra teamed up with Renee Guillory-Wearing and now perform as The Ritchie Family, having registered the name. In 2016, they released their first single in nearly 40 years, Ice, which reached #40 on Billboard's Dance Charts. In 2021, a new track Whatcha Got, was released.
